On November 5, 2025, KGA CO., LTD announced the issuance of 148,957 new shares resulting from the exercise of convertible bond rights, an event officially filed and available in this Official Disclosure. These new shares represent approximately 1.18% of the company’s market capitalization.
The immediate effect of this issuance is an increase in the number of outstanding shares, which often leads to a short-term dilution of shareholder value. Furthermore, with the current stock price (KRW 5,220) trading significantly above the conversion price, there is a high probability of profit-taking by bondholders. This could introduce significant selling pressure, potentially driving the stock outlook down in the short term. While KGA has benefited from its KOSDAQ listing and recent mergers, which boosted its fundraising capabilities and brand visibility, its recent performance paints a concerning picture. The company is strategically pursuing new growth areas like solid-state batteries and dry electrode processes, but its core business is facing headwinds.
Positive Developments: The company is building a foundation for future R&D and exploring next-generation battery technologies. It is also actively working to diversify its customer base to reduce dependency on a few key clients.
Negative Indicators (H1 2025): Revenue plummeted by 40% YoY to KRW 16.542 billion, and operating profit fell nearly 50%. The company swung to a net loss of KRW -5.408 billion, primarily due to merger-related expenses. This decline, coupled with a high debt burden and exposure to foreign exchange risks, raises red flags.
A review of KGA’s financial projections reveals a trend of slowing growth and eroding profitability. The operating profit is forecasted to turn negative in 2025, a significant concern for any KGA stock analysis.
The global secondary battery market holds long-term promise, but short-term realities are harsh. As noted by industry reports from sources like BloombergNEF, major battery manufacturers are scaling back capital expenditures amidst a temporary slowdown in EV demand. This directly impacts equipment suppliers like KGA. Additionally, macroeconomic factors such as rising KRW/USD and KRW/EUR exchange rates create further financial risk due to the company’s foreign currency-denominated debt.
